How to Get Saab Keys Replacement
The owners of 03-11 saab 9-5 key replacement 9-3 vehicles will recognize that their ignition keys are prone to wear and wear and tear. The loss of a key or losing it can be extremely stressful.
Replacing the key alone is expensive. It requires the purchase of a new car computer module (SAAB CIM or SAAB TWICE) as well as programming.

Misplacing Keys
It's easy for car owners to lose their keys. If you place your keys in a pocket and then jump in the shower to prepare for dinner or work then they're likely to "drift away" from their original place. This is why it's important to always have an extra key in your bag.
If you're missing your key-fob the best place to begin looking is where you normally keep it. It's also recommended to check pockets in the clothes you were wearing at the time. The same applies to any other items you might have carried like handbags or purses.
For older SAAB models that were manufactured between 2003 and the present, you can add an additional key fob to your vehicle, however you must have at least one of the existing keys to ensure that the new fob is able to be linked with the vehicle. This is only possible through the dealer with a Tech2 device.
A service technician from a dealer will charge about $200 to program a new key fob if they need to replace one that has been lost. A mobile SAAB locksmith can reprogram your computer EEPROM, and prepare your vehicle for the new key. This service is a fraction of the cost. This service is extremely popular with those who are down to one key that works.

Key fobs that are used to lock and unlock your vehicle contain batteries. They can also fail over time. Replace the battery in your car key fob on a regular basis to avoid it failing when you're most in need of it.
The process of replacing a battery in the key fob is simple and doesn't require any special tools. You'll first have to remove the emergency fob from the case by inserting a flathead into the slot in the middle and gently opening the key fob. You can then take off the electronics and replace them with a new battery.
